Chapter 634: Death Is the End of the World, and Things Are Unpredictable

The incident of Xu Zhimo's death is not much different from that in history.

Yesterday, Xu Zhimo and Lu Xiaoman had another quarrel at home, and then he took the train to Jinling alone. This morning, he was going to take a plane to Beijing, because tonight he was going to attend the Chinese architectural art lecture held by Lin Huiyin for foreign envoys in the Peking Union Medical College Auditorium.

For this lecture, Lin Huiyin also called Ye Luo to inform him that he could come to see it if he was free, but because of the recent resignation of the principal and the Wanrong incident, Ye Luo was unable to get away and had to politely refuse.

After quarreling with Xu Zhimo, Lu Xiaoman stayed at home angrily and did not accompany him to Beijing.

Xu Zhimo also notified Liang Sicheng in advance to send a car to pick him up, but Liang Sicheng waited at the airport until 4:30 pm today, but Xu Zhimo did not come.

Liang Sicheng, who was puzzled, called from Beijing, and after several rounds of transfers, he finally learned that the China Airlines "Jinan" mail plane that Xu Zhimo was riding on had crashed due to bad weather.

Lin Ruxian told Ye Luo that after getting the news from Liang Sicheng, she sent someone to China Aviation Company and also asked officials from relevant departments in Jinling.

It is said that when the plane arrived in Dangjiazhuang, south of the capital of Shandong Province, there was suddenly a thick fog and it was difficult to tell the direction.

In order to find the correct route, the pilot had to lower the flight altitude. Unexpectedly, the plane hit the mountain and immediately fell into the valley. The fuselage caught fire and all the people on board (two crew members and Xu Zhimo) died.

Regarding the cause of Xu Zhimo's death, it is tentatively determined that there was a heavy fog, the main crew member Wang Guanyi was busy preparing for his daughter's wedding the night before, and he was too energetic during the flight.

"There are unexpected changes in the sky." Ye Luo sighed. After traveling through time, Xu Zhimo was one of his few good friends in China.

Since Xu Zhimo and Lu Xiaoman got married, they came to Shanghai from Peking to live. It was when Ye Luo started his car business.

I still remember that on the day when Ye's car dealership opened, Xu Zhimo brought Lu Xiaoman's paintings to celebrate.

As Ye Luo's business grew, the friendship between the three never changed. Ye Luo also helped them stabilize many unstable factors in their marriage.

I never thought that Xu Zhimo would die in this disaster.

"I'm afraid it's not a natural disaster or a man-made disaster." Lin Ruxian whispered.

At this time, the Japanese invaders invaded the north, and Ye Luo was fighting with many forces, fighting openly and secretly.

Although Xu Zhimo was not a politician, he was quite famous in the literary and educational circles, and he was keen on resisting Japan and saving the country and criticizing the internal struggles of the Kuomintang.

The sudden crash of the plane inevitably made people wonder whether it was related to political struggles.

What Lin Ruxian and others were more worried about was that this was a disguised warning from the Japanese invaders to Ye Luo.

Ye Luo took in Wanrong and Jin Bihui, which was equivalent to publicly tearing his face with the Japanese invaders. The Japanese Consul General in Shanghai, Shichitaro Yada, wanted to eat Ye Luo alive.

It is possible that the death of Xu Zhimo could be used to attack Ye Luo.

Ye Luo looked at Lin Ruxian, then glanced at Lu Xiaoman and others, and said in a low voice: "Just in case, sister-in-law, send more people to protect the Ye Mansion, and then let Yongzhen and others secretly investigate to see if it is really related to the Japanese."

"I know, don't worry, leave it to me." Lin Ruxian is the oldest among these women and has experienced the most ups and downs. Xiao Aqiao is now busy at home nursing the baby, so she is the second mistress of Ye's investment.

After talking about these, Ye Luo returned to Lu Xiaoman and patted her back to comfort her.

Lu Xiaoman cried like a tearful person: "Wow, wow, Ah Luo, if I had known this, I shouldn't have said those harsh words to him last night, and if I had been more frugal. Zhimo, Zhimo wouldn't have to make cargo planes, maybe..."

"Xiaoman, now that things have come to this, don't take all the responsibility on yourself." Ye Luo knew that Lu Xiaoman was the one who suffered the most this time, but he had no choice but to comfort her softly, and then help to take care of Xu Zhimo's funeral.

After his death, Xu's family and his ex-wife Zhang Youyi couldn't sit still, and it was estimated that they would soon rush to Shanghai.

As one of Xu Zhimo's best friends during his lifetime, Ye Luo naturally had to take on the position of chairman of the funeral committee.

Lu Xiaoman really blamed herself now.

Since coming to Shanghai, her expenses have been getting bigger and bigger. For her, Xu Zhimo had to take on several positions and travel to many places, often exhausted.

After Zhang Youyi broke up with Tang Ying and the others last time, Lu Xiaoman lost her stable source of income. She was too embarrassed to go back to the Black Cat Ballroom to work and get money, so she was gloomy at home all day.

Although Tang Ying and the others reconciled with her with the help of Ye Luo, she couldn't make money after all, so she couldn't be thick-skinned and stick to them again.

As time went by, the expenses became bigger and bigger, and the core conflict between her and Xu Zhimo broke out again.

Last night, because Xu Zhimo insisted on attending Lin Huiyin's speech, the two had a big quarrel, and Xu Zhimo left in anger. In the end, he had no money and had to take a cargo plane to Beijing.

If it weren't for these things, she felt that Xu Zhimo should have gone to Beijing normally.

After this incident, Ye Luo couldn't leave Shanghai again in the near future.

Moreover, Xu Zhimo's body had not been claimed yet, so he had to accompany Lu Xiaoman to claim the remains.

But before they set out to claim the remains, Xu Zhimo's unexpected death and the tragic condition before his death became well-known news.

According to various tabloid reports, Xu Zhimo's death was extremely tragic.

Not only were his hands and feet burned to charcoal, there was also a big hole in his head, and half of his body was completely broken.

It seems that Xu Zhimo suffered inhuman torture before his death, and did not die suddenly.

After learning the news from the newspaper, Lu Xiaoman became even more frightened. She was afraid that she would collapse when she saw her husband's tragic condition.

Therefore, she never had the courage to go to the scene to claim the body. No matter how Ye Luo persuaded her, she would not move. She kept curling up in her bed at home, looking pitiful.

Later, there was really no way, so Ye Luo had to go to Zhang Youyi.

Zhang Youyi was much stronger than Lu Xiaoman. She endured the severe pain and took Xu Zhimo's son Xu Rusun to the scene to claim the body.

Finally, a few days later, with the help of Ye Luo and others, Zhang Youyi transported Xu Zhimo's body back to Shanghai and sent it to the funeral home for burial.

After Xu Zhimo's body was transported back to Shanghai, Lu Xiaoman saw the only relic on the scene—a long scroll of landscape painting.

This painting was created by Lu Xiaoman this spring and can be regarded as Lu Xiaoman's early representative work. What is more precious is its inscription. Xu Zhimo brought this scroll with him, intending to ask someone to add inscriptions in Beijing. However, because the scroll was placed in an iron box, it was not buried with the person.

Lu Xiaoman looked at the scroll and thought of Xu Zhimo's good qualities, and she couldn't help crying.

After Xu Zhimo's death, Lu Xiaoman vowed not to go out to socialize, but to stay at home and concentrate on painting, like a different person.

Not long after, Ye Luo held a rather grand funeral for Xu Zhimo in the name of the chairman of the funeral committee.

Things are unpredictable. Lin Huiyin and her husband failed to wait for their friends to attend their lecture, and had to go south to Shanghai to attend the funeral.

Lin Huiyin also wanted to come, but because of her pregnancy and poor health, she could not resist Liang Sicheng's insistence and could only pay tribute to him from afar at home. She called Ye Luo several times to express her thoughts and condolences.

Everyone was stained with a layer of haze in their hearts because of Xu Zhimo's death.

The funeral was held as scheduled, and Lin Ruxian was also continuously investigating the truth of the plane crash.

Perhaps this was really an accident. With the power of Ye's investment, no trace of the trick could be found out.

But while investigating, Lin Ruxian found something interesting and useful! (End of this chapter)
